A bit about the job:
You’ll be part of Aviva’s Agile Centre of Excellence – a team dedicated to embedding Agile ways of working across the organisation.
This hands-on coaching role supports the rollout of SAFe, improves delivery performance, and helps build high-performing teams.
You’ll deliver accredited training, coach teams and leaders, and shape scalable Agile practices that align with our strategic goals.
Your work will directly contribute to faster time to market and better customer outcomes.
Skills and experience we’re looking for:
Proven experience leading Agile transformations using SAFe, ideally in finance or insurance
Certified SAFe Program Consultant (SPC) with experience delivering SAFe training
Strong coaching and facilitation skills, with the ability to influence at all levels
Deep understanding of Agile frameworks including Scrum, Kanban, and SAFe
Comfortable working across multiple teams with varying Agile maturity
